Ahmed Shah group sweeps Arts Council polls 2021-22.

KARACHI -- The Ahmed Shah-Ejaz Faruqi Panel has swept the election of the Arts Council of Pakistan Karachi 2021-2022, as none of the single candidate of the rival groups, Democrate Arts Forum and Arts Forum Panel could managed to return successful on the slot of member governing body.

Around 2135 members had cast their votes during the poll, of them 61 were rejected. Muhammad Ahmed Shah secured 1830 votes and was re-elected as president of the ACP for the next two years.

Haseena Moin secured 1825 and elected as vice president, Prof Aijaz Faruqi bagged 1851 votes and elected as Secretary while Asjad Bukhari got 1733 votes to win the post of Joint Secretary.

All 12 candidates of the governing body also returned victorious including Talat Hussain (1903) votes, Dr Qaiser Sajad (1857), Kashif Girami (1844), Qudsia Akbar (1838), Munawar Saeed (1808), Iqbal Lateef (1797), Noorul Huda Shah (1790), Amber Haseeb (1778), Saadat Jaffery (1756), Bashir Sadozai (1718), Nusrat Harris (1665) and Dr Ayub Shaikh (1657).

The Elections were held on Sunday under the supervision of Chief Election Commissioner, Commissioner Karachi in which a contest was held between Ahmad Shah Ijaz Farooqi, Democratic Arts Forum and Arts Forum panel.
